Shengyang Luo is a materials scientist and additive manufacturing researcher whose work focuses on advancing the 3D printing of high-performance elastomers. His key research areas include polymer processing, fused deposition modeling (FDM), and the development of stretchable materials for flexible electronics and soft robotics. Luo’s most notable contribution is his pioneering work on pellet-based 3D printing of high stretchable elastomers, published in 2024, which has already garnered 10 citations—a strong early impact indicator. This research addresses critical limitations in traditional elastomer manufacturing by demonstrating a novel FDM-compatible approach that preserves the material’s exceptional flexibility and stretchability, opening new possibilities for custom, complex geometries in high-tech applications. Luo’s work is particularly significant for bridging the gap between conventional elastomer processing and additive manufacturing, offering a scalable, cost-effective solution for producing durable, stretchable parts.
